Dharadgaon - Pansemal, Barwani

Dharadgaon is a village situated in the Pansemal tehsil of Barwani district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 5 km from the tehsil headquarters in Pansemal and around 90 km from the district headquarters in Barwani. Aamada serves as the Gram Panchayat for Dharadgaon village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Dharadgaon is 478424. The village covers a total geographical area of 314.59 hectares and falls under the 451770 pincode. Pansemal is the nearest town, located about 5 km away.

Dharadgaon village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Pansemal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Khargone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Dharadgaon

As per Census 2011, Dharadgaon village has a total population of 456 people, consisting of 227 males and 229 females. The village has 83 households and a sex ratio of 1,008 females per 1,000 males. There are 76 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 213 literate and 243 illiterate residents. Additionally, 23 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 433 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Dharadgaon

Dharadgaon is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Dondaicha, while the nearest airport is Jalgaon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 99.7 km.

The road distance from Pansemal to Dharadgaon is about 5 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Barwani to Dharadgaon is about 90 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.6 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
